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S
To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to satisfactorily perform each essential function listed below.
Services and Supports:
Direct Support: Provides direct support or assistance in accordance with individual service or program plans; assists with socialization and behavioral development, personal care, housekeeping, recreational activities, transportation, community orientation, shopping, financial management, citizenship, and other activities of daily living.
Records: Accurately documents progress and activity; reviews records and logs to stay abreast of changes in service plans; maintains confidentiality.
Management of Individuals' Assets: Makes cost-effective and appropriate purchases within the budget of the individual served and according to their choice / preference
Relationships: Maintains healthy and professional relationships with individuals, friends, families, guardians and case managers; greets family members and other visitors; implements Sevita Customer Service Standards.
Reporting: Reports any instance of alleged abuse or neglect according to internal and external standards; reports medical, behavioral and other incidents in accordance with Sevita policy and external requirements.
Rights: Maintains confidentiality, respects the rights of persons being served, according to applicable the bill of rights; practices universal precautions; assists individuals in exercising their rights.
Health Care:
Appointments: As needed, may accompany individuals to medical appointments; relays orders and information to and from medical providers as required.
Medications: If assigned, accurately administers or supports self-administration of medication and documents delivery of medications and treatments; promptly reports administration errors; maintains appropriate security of controlled medications and other medications and supplies.
General Health Care: Monitors individual's health; documents health concerns; communicates with nurse or supervisor as appropriate; calls 911 in the event of emergency; follows individual health care directives.
Medical Supplies and Equipment: Correctly follows procedures in utilizing medical equipment; reports malfunction or disrepair.
Meal Preparation: Prepares or supports individuals to prepare food in accordance with planned menus and individual choice; knows special diets and prepares individual meals accordingly; monitors mealtime and correctly implements any dining plans.
Employment Responsibilities:
Training: Attends orientation and on-going training as directed; participates in monthly staff meetings.
Employee Scheduling: Works scheduled hours; arrives for work on time; stays on shift until replacement arrives; notifies supervisor in advance when unable to work as scheduled or as soon as possible after the designated start time; may fill in for other shifts where required without causing unapproved overtime, or in the event of emergency.
Teamwork: Works together with others, values others contributions; is courteous; communicates openly; listens; and shows respect to others.
Workplace Safety: Every employee plays a role in developing and maintaining a safe workplace; complies with all established safety policies, procedures, and rules; reports unsafe hazards to their supervisor and participates in safety related training or activities.
Maintenance:
Vehicles: May transport individuals into the community; drives safely and according to local laws; ensures proper use of safety equipment including seat belts, lifts and wheelchair ties; reports accidents to appropriate authorities immediately; reports accidents and safety concerns immediately to supervisor or maintenance personnel.
Housekeeping: Performs daily and seasonal housekeeping as directed; maintains neat, clean and safe environment; reports hazards or safety concerns.
Maintenance and Repair: Monitors environmental safety and may make minor repairs, change light bulbs, etc.; may perform yard maintenance including keeping walkways safe and snow removal; reports equipment or facilities requiring repairs to supervisor or maintenance personnel as required.
Safety: Checks water temperature as required when assisting with bathing; participates in safety drills and protects persons being served in the event of emergency.

POSITION SUMMARY:
This caretaker position provides personal cares, medication administration, assists with special activities, and cleaning to all residents that reside in the CBRF units at the Health Care Campus to ensure safety and overall assistance as guided by an Individual Service Plan. This position is available for Full-Time, Part-Time or On-Call.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
The following duties are normal for this position. These are not to be construed as exclusive or all-inclusive. To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each duty satisfactorily. Other duties may be required and assigned.
Record pertinent information pertaining to the resident's care.
Assist residents with medication administration at the appropriate time.
Plan and prepare meals according to specific dietary requirements of the resident, and if necessary, feeding the resident.
Assist the resident with therapy exercises under the direction of a Licensed Therapist.
Assist or perform personal care including but not limited to hair care, oral hygiene, bathing, grooming, and dressing.
Assist with ambulation with or without mechanical aids.
Assist with routine bodily functions such as toileting.
Maintain a safe, clean and healthy environment through light housekeeping including changing bed linens, dusting and vacuuming, cleaning kitchen and bathroom, and laundry.
Provide companionship and stimulation for the resident including reading, walks, or other approved activities.
Accompany resident to approved community activities away from the CBRF.
Perform other housekeeping tasks as indicated in the care plan.
Take resident's vital signs and recording input and output.
Observe and report changes in resident's condition to appropriate Registered Nurse staff.
